Pronombres. Object pronouns. Ya sabemos que el pronombre sujeto ‘ Subject Pronoun ’ (pronombre personal que funciona como sujeto) realiza la acción y siempre precede al verbo. En los siguientes ejemplos, el Subject Pronoun (o pronombre sujeto) será: I, He y They. I love dancing. He has bought a car. They eat bananas.
25 de dic. de 2023 · We use he/him to refer to men, and she/her to refer to women. When we are not sure if we are talking about a man or a woman, we use they/them: This is Jack. He's my brother. I don't think you have met him. This is Angela.
